Navigating the Landscape of Online Casino Bonuses

Online casino bonuses are a cornerstone of attracting and retaining players. These can range from welcome bonuses for new sign-ups to loyalty rewards for consistent play. However, it’s crucial to approach these offers with a discerning eye. Often, bonuses come with wagering requirements, meaning players must gamble a specified amount before they can withdraw any winnings. These requirements can significantly impact the real value of a bonus. For example, a 100% deposit match bonus with a 40x wagering requirement means a player must wager 40 times the bonus amount before being eligible for a payout. Understanding these terms and conditions is paramount to avoiding disappointment and ensuring a fair gaming experience. Many players overlook the fine print, leading to frustration when attempting to cash out funds. It's a common trap, and a careful reading of the bonus policy is truly essential.

The Importance of Responsible Gaming While Utilizing Bonuses

While bonuses can enhance the playing experience, they should never be seen as a guaranteed path to riches. Responsible gaming principles are especially important when utilizing bonus funds. Setting a budget and sticking to it is paramount, as is understanding the concept of "house edge." The house edge represents the casino's advantage in any given game, and it ensures that, over the long term, the casino will always come out on top. Players should view bonuses as a form of entertainment rather than a risk-free opportunity to make money. Chasing losses in an attempt to meet wagering requirements can quickly lead to financial difficulties. A sensible approach includes understanding that bonuses are tools for engagement, not guarantees of profit.

Bonus Type Typical Wagering Requirement Notes
Welcome Bonus 30x – 50x Often requires a deposit
No Deposit Bonus 60x – 90x Higher wagering requirements due to the lack of initial investment
Free Spins 35x – 45x Winnings from free spins are usually subject to wagering
Loyalty Bonus 20x – 30x Typically lower requirements for regular players

This table offers a quick reference for common bonus types and their associated wagering expectations. Remember this is an approximation, and the exact details will always be outlined in the specific casino’s terms and conditions. Always prioritize transparency and clarity when evaluating an offer.

The Role of Cognitive Biases in Gambling Decisions

Cognitive biases, systematic patterns of deviation from normatively rational judgment, play a significant role in gambling decisions. The gambler’s fallacy, for example, is the belief that past events influence future independent events. A player might believe that after a series of losses, a win is “due,” even though each spin of the roulette wheel or deal of a card is independent. Confirmation bias, the tendency to seek out information that confirms pre-existing beliefs, can also lead players to overestimate their chances of winning. Similarly, the illusion of control, the belief that one can influence random events, can encourage players to engage in superstitious behaviors or develop elaborate betting systems. Understanding these biases can help players make more rational decisions and avoid costly mistakes. Recognizing these distortions in thinking is a critical step towards responsible gambling.

Strategies for Identifying and Addressing Problem Gambling

Recognizing the signs of problem gambling is the first step towards addressing it. These signs can include spending increasing amounts of money and time gambling, chasing losses, lying to family and friends about gambling activities, and experiencing feelings of guilt or shame. Financial difficulties, relationship problems, and neglecting responsibilities are also common indicators. If you or someone you know is struggling with problem gambling, seeking help is essential. Numerous resources are available, including national helplines, support groups, and therapy. Self-exclusion programs, which allow players to voluntarily ban themselves from online casinos, can also be a valuable tool. Early intervention is crucial, as problem gambling can have devastating consequences on individuals and their families.

Resources for Support and Recovery

Several organizations are dedicated to providing support and resources for individuals struggling with gambling addiction. The National Council on Problem Gambling (NCPG) offers a helpline and website with information about local support groups and treatment options. Gamblers Anonymous (GA) provides a 12-step program similar to Alcoholics Anonymous. Many online casinos also offer self-assessment tools and links to responsible gambling resources. Therapy, particularly c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), can be highly effective in addressing the underlying psychological factors contributing to problem gambling. Remember, se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ness. Recovering from gambling addiction is a challenging process, but it is possible with the right support and resources.
